The tallest building in the world designed by a woman, Arq. Jeanne Gang.
101 stories, 1191 feet tall
Floor 83 is a blow through floor that together with 6 tanks (400,000 gallons of water) in the tower top counter act the sway of the blowing wind
The main Stem, North Branch, and South Branch of the Chicago River come together at the Confluence. With the L trains crossing on Lake Street, and the beginning of Chicago's Riverwalk, its always a busy spot - even when the boats aren't out.
